A year defined by blockbuster fiction, self‑help sensations, and the unstoppable rise of romantasy, 2025 has delivered one of the most dynamic literary markets in recent years. Readers gravitated toward empowering nonfiction, cinematic dystopias, and sweeping fantasy sagas — and a handful of authors dominated the charts with millions of copies sold worldwide.
Drawing on verified sales data from Circana BookScan and reporting from Publishers Weekly, these are the top five bestselling authors of 2025.
1. Mel Robbins
Key title: The Let Them Theory
Estimated 2025 sales: 1.76 million+ copies
Mel Robbins continues her reign as one of the most influential voices in personal development. The Let Them Theory became the #1 bestselling book of 2025, resonating with readers seeking clarity, boundaries, and emotional resilience. Robbins’ blend of practical psychology and conversational tone has made her a global phenomenon — and 2025 cemented her status as the year’s top-selling author.
2. Suzanne Collins
Key title: Sunrise on the Reaping
Estimated 2025 sales: 1.69 million+ copies
Collins’ return to Panem electrified the publishing world. Sunrise on the Reaping, the fifth installment in The Hunger Games universe, delivered a gritty, character‑driven prequel that captivated both longtime fans and new readers. Its massive sales reflect the enduring cultural power of Collins’ dystopian storytelling.
3. Rebecca Yarros
Key titles: Onyx Storm (standard & deluxe editions), Fourth Wing
Estimated 2025 sales: Over 2 million combined for Onyx Storm editions alone
Romantasy is the genre of the moment, and Rebecca Yarros is its undisputed queen. The release of Onyx Storm — in both standard and deluxe formats — dominated charts, while earlier titles like Fourth Wing continued to surge. Yarros’ blend of romance, dragons, and high‑stakes fantasy has created a global fanbase that shows no signs of slowing.
4. Freida McFadden
Key titles: The Housemaid, The Crash
Estimated 2025 sales: 400,000–500,000+ per title
Freida McFadden has become a thriller powerhouse. Her psychological suspense novels — twisty, fast‑paced, and compulsively readable — consistently land on bestseller lists. In 2025, The Housemaid and The Crash both secured top‑10 positions, proving McFadden’s remarkable staying power in a crowded genre.
5. Dav Pilkey
Key title: Big Jim Begins (Dog Man #13)
Estimated 2025 sales: 500,000+ copies
Children’s publishing remains one of the most robust sectors of the book market, and Dav Pilkey continues to lead it. The thirteenth Dog Man installment, Big Jim Begins, delivered another blockbuster performance. Pilkey’s humor, visual storytelling, and universal appeal keep him firmly among the world’s bestselling authors.
